The Commonwealth Bank presents an "Electronic Banking Product Disclosure
Statement" which runs to 33 pages when printed every time they make a change.
There is no indication as to where the variation concerns, and changes occur
fairly frequently. I note it doesn't seem possible to download a copy
either.
I'd be surprised if this triumph of corporate wankery over common sense has
much legal force as a valid method of advertising changes, and I intend to
write to the NSW Dept. of Fair Trading on the matter.
